{"data":{"id":"us-id/idaho-code-54-916a","jurisdiction":"us-id","citation":"Idaho Code § 54-916A","heading":"Dental hygiene licensure by credentials.","body":"The board may issue a license to practice dental hygiene without further examination to an applicant upon evidence that:\n(1) The applicant currently holds an active license in good standing to practice dental hygiene in another state with no disciplinary proceedings or unresolved complaints pending before the state’s licensing board;\n(2) The applicant has been licensed for at least one (1) year and the applicant has practiced a minimum of one thousand (1,000) hours in the two (2) years immediately preceding the date of application;\n(3) The applicant has graduated from a dental hygiene school accredited by the commission on dental accreditation of the American dental association as of the date of the applicant’s graduation;\n(4) The applicant has successfully completed a board approved clinical examination;\n(5) The applicant has successfully completed the national board dental hygiene examination; and\n(6) The applicant has paid the application fee as set by board rule.","path":["TITLE 54 PROFESSIONS, VOCATIONS, AND BUSINESSES","CHAPTER 9 DENTISTS"],"source_url":"https://legislature.idaho.gov/statutesrules/idstat/title54/t54ch9/sect54-916a/","current_through":"2026 Legislative Session","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-04T11:22:48Z","sha256":"9ce9167ba4d7f1b1660e59ae926e75bb3cf3e0dba248f776e88e430ee842ff45","source_id":"us-id","stale":false,"prev":"us-id/idaho-code-54-916","next":"us-id/idaho-code-54-916b"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
